About Carole Jean
Carole Jean Hayes practices personal injury law in Greenville, South Carolina. A member of the South Carolina Bar since her admission in 1990, she has dedicated over three decades to advocating for individuals who have suffered injuries due to accidents, workplace incidents. Other personal injury claims throughout the state. Her firm focuses on providing comprehensive legal representation, ensuring that clients receive the support they need during difficult periods. In 1990, Carole earned her Juris Doctor (J.D.) from Memphis State Law School after completing her undergraduate studies at George Mason University, where she received a Bachelor of Arts (B.A.) in 1987. While in law school, she worked as a judicial clerk in 1989.
